Transaction 43ebad54dabb8ecb0b50b4bcd73ce02747cd79b894633a6034ae8f31fa150068

1 Input
2 Outputs
  • 43ebad54dabb8ecb0b50b4bcd73ce02747cd79b894633a6034ae8f31fa150068:0
  • value  837470
    address  2NBMEXMfQUNVF1WkqxNvE5sTS2Lseeo32wX
  • 43ebad54dabb8ecb0b50b4bcd73ce02747cd79b894633a6034ae8f31fa150068:1
  • value  3411324397
    address  2N5SSyPtyrpPFpthXKLDmqx8ahUNpFQmweh